The Device and Arrhythmia Society of Tanzania (DAST) is an organization dedicated to advancing the field of cardiac electrophysiology and the management of cardiac arrhythmias within Tanzania. Founded with the mission of improving healthcare outcomes related to heart rhythm disorders, DAST focuses on several key objectives:


Education and Training

DAST aims to enhance the knowledge and skills of healthcare professionals involved in the diagnosis and treatment of arrhythmias. This includes organizing workshops, seminars, and training programs to disseminate the latest advancements in electrophysiology and device therapies.


Research and Innovation

The society promotes research initiatives aimed at better understanding the epidemiology of arrhythmias in Tanzania, as well as exploring innovative approaches to their management. By fostering a culture of research, DAST seeks to contribute to global knowledge while addressing local healthcare challenges.

Advocacy and Awareness

DAST advocates for improved access to diagnostic tools, medications, and device therapies essential for the effective management of arrhythmia. Additionally, the society works to raise public awareness about heart rhythm disorders, their symptoms, and the importance of timely medical intervention.

Collaboration and Networking

DAST fosters collaboration among healthcare professionals, researchers, and policymakers both within Tanzania and internationally. By leveraging partnerships, the society aims to strengthen the overall capacity for managing arrhythmias and improving cardiovascular health outcomes nationwide.

Clinical Practice Guidelines

DAST collaborates with national and international experts to develop evidence-based clZnical practice guidelines tailored to the Tanzanian context. These guidelines serve as a framework for healthcare providers in the diagnosis, treatment, and follow-up of patients with arrhythmia and related conditions.

AIMS AND OBJECTIVES

The goal of DAR-TANZANIA is to improve the knowledge and practice among
medical professionals dealing with cardiac arrhythmia patients and the welfare of

persons living with rhythm disorder in Tanzania.

To these ends, the objectives of DAR-TANZANIA are: -

  • To promote medical and other scientific research pertaining heart rhythm disorders.
  • To promote a free knowledge exchange with respect of heart rhythm diseases.
  • To develop the appropriate models of health care and appropriate interventions for people with heart rhythm diseases.
  • To monitor heart rhythm diseases and the risk factors in order to collect data on the effects of prevention, treatment and care that are essential for priority
  • To educate to the general public the prevention and early recognition of heart rhythm Symptoms
  • To promote the affordable quality health care for people with heart rhythm diseases.
  • To develop educational programs for persons with heart rhythm diseases to understand their disease.
  • To provide organizational means for cardiac rhythm specialists to come together as a professional body and to project its outlook and image in the interests of the society.
  • To promote interest of cardiac rhythm specialists in different parts of the country and to foster friendship, professional communication and understanding amongst them.
  • To encourage and provide opportunities for junior medical doctors to identify cardiac rhythm disorders of the patients they serve and utilize their skills and training in solving or alleviating such burden of cardiac rhythm complications.
  • To maintain and improve the standard of professional competence and conduct of all members of the cardiac rhythm specialists.
  • To foster solidarity with other associations and institutions within and outside Tanzania in advancing the society objectives without changing its status.
  • To establish an effective information center for purpose of enhancing the standard of professional expertise.
  • To print, publish and publicize the activities of the society.
  • To advocate for policy changes in the health sector in favor of Community wellbeing and cardiac rhythm society.
